Comparing Kubernetes Maintenance Costs with a Zero-Maintenance Alternative Platform for Multicloud Deployments
Comparing Kubernetes Maintenance Costs with a Zero-Maintenance Alternative Platform for Multicloud Deployments
As businesses increasingly adopt multicloud strategies, the choice of platform for managing containerized applications becomes crucial. Kubernetes, a leading open-source container orchestration tool, is often the go-to solution for many organizations. However, it presents certain maintenance challenges and costs that can affect the overall efficiency and budget of the IT department. In contrast, zero-maintenance alternative platforms offer a compelling proposition by alleviating the overhead associated with managing Kubernetes clusters. This article explores the differences in maintenance costs between these two approaches, providing a comprehensive comparison to help decision-makers choose the right platform for their multicloud deployments.
Understanding Kubernetes Maintenance Costs
Kubernetes is known for its robust capabilities and flexibility, but with great power comes significant responsibility. The maintenance of a Kubernetes environment involves several layers, including infrastructure management, cluster upgrades, security patches, and continuous monitoring. These activities often require a dedicated team of skilled professionals, which can lead to substantial operational expenses.
Moreover, the complexity of Kubernetes can result in increased downtime if not managed properly, leading to potential revenue losses. Organizations must invest in training and development to ensure their teams are equipped to handle the intricacies of Kubernetes, further adding to the cost.
The Zero-Maintenance Alternative
Zero-maintenance platforms, such as managed Kubernetes services or Platform as a Service (PaaS) solutions, offer a contrasting approach. These platforms abstract the underlying infrastructure and provide automated updates, scaling, and security management, eliminating the need for dedicated maintenance teams. This allows organizations to focus on their core business objectives rather than the complexities of infrastructure management.
In terms of cost, zero-maintenance platforms typically offer predictable pricing models, which can be more manageable for budgeting purposes. Additionally, by reducing the need for specialized personnel, businesses can allocate resources more efficiently, potentially resulting in significant cost savings.
Comparative Analysis
The choice between Kubernetes and a zero-maintenance platform should be driven by an organization’s specific needs and capabilities. While Kubernetes offers unmatched flexibility and control, the associated maintenance costs can be prohibitive for some businesses. Zero-maintenance platforms, on the other hand, provide ease of use and reduced operational overhead but may lack the customization options that Kubernetes offers.
Ultimately, the decision will depend on factors such as the complexity of the deployment, the availability of in-house expertise, and the organization’s budget constraints. For businesses with limited resources or those new to multicloud strategies, a zero-maintenance platform might be the ideal choice. Conversely, organizations with established IT teams and complex requirements might find Kubernetes a more suitable option.
Conclusion
In conclusion, while Kubernetes remains a powerful tool for managing containerized applications in multicloud environments, the maintenance costs associated with it can be significant. Zero-maintenance platforms offer a streamlined alternative, allowing organizations to minimize operational overhead and focus on innovation. Decision-makers should carefully evaluate their organization's needs, expertise, and budget to select the most appropriate platform for their multicloud deployments.
```